The Game Changer: Mastering Gamecraft and Leveraging the Score
Episode 17
Wednesday, 15 January, 2025

In this revolutionary episode of the Art of Winning Tennis Revolution, hosts Styrling Strother and Dan Travis unveil a transformative approach to tennis strategy that challenges conventional wisdom and redefines the game. Titled "The Game Changer: Mastering Gamecraft and Leveraging the Score," this episode dives deep into the intricacies of gamecraft and its critical role in achieving tennis success. Styrling shares insights from his latest research, conducted in the Art of Winning laboratory, where he identified pivotal patterns that can revolutionize traditional tennis thinking. Together with Dan, they dissect these discoveries, exploring how understanding and implementing these principles can give players a significant competitive edge. The episode starts by discussing the importance of recognizing and leveraging the "30 position" and the "40 position" in a match. Styrling and Dan explain why these positions are crucial and how mastering them can dictate the flow of the game. They highlight fascinating statistics, such as men winning 80% of games when reaching 40 first, and women winning 72% under the same conditions, illustrating the power of understanding the conversion and momentum pathways. Listeners will gain insights into the three phases of a game—the beginning, middle, and end—and how to optimize performance at each stage based on the Momentum Score. Styrling and Dan also delve into the role of momentum and probability, revealing how these elements interact with the score to influence outcomes. As the discussion progresses, the hosts introduce the concept of "Pathways," providing detailed examples and scenarios to help players and coaches apply these strategies in real-time. They emphasize the importance of data-driven decision-making and how to rehearse critical scenarios on the practice court.
